7. Linguistic Exegesis
The verse opens with a coordinate list of four place names—ayin {עַ֥יִן | ʿă-yîn} ‘Ain’, rimmon {רִמּ֖וֹן | rim-môn} ‘Rimmon’, wā-ʿe-ter {וָעֶ֣תֶר | wā-ʿe-ter} ‘and Eter’, and wə-ʿā-šān {וְעָשָׁ֑ן | wə-ʿā-šān} ‘and Ashan’—joined by the conjunction waw. This is followed by arim {עָרִים | ʿă-rîm} ‘towns’ and the feminine numeral arba {אַרְבַּע | ʾăr-bāʿ} ‘four’, where the form of the number agrees with the feminine noun. The final construct chain wə-ḥa-ṣer-ê-hen {וְחַצְרֵיהֶן | wə-ḥa-ṣer-ê-hen} ‘and their villages’ links ancillary settlements to the main towns. In English the list is preserved and then summarized, with agreement rendered naturally and the construct relationship indicated by “their.”
